I had the exact same symptoms happen with my very tiny poodle about 9 years ago. I came home to find the exact same symptoms with him that you are describing. Like you, it scared me half to death. My dog eventually was diagnosed with irritable bowel disease. They started my dog on antibiotics, steroids, and a very bland prescription diet. He began to do much much better. He still had a little bit of blood in his stool for a few days initially, but as the medicine got into his system, it stopped completely. This might be something totally different than what is going on with your baby, but thought I'd share what happened with us. I will keep your baby in my prayers!!!
